TIGER SET TO FINISH 6TH
London, 4th April 2007 – Spread Betting Bookmakers Sporting Index today revealed their menu of bets on this week’s Masters and among them is the prediction that Tiger Woods will only finish in 6th place. Punters have to decide whether he’ll finish worse than 7th or better than 5th. What they eventually win or lose depends on the stake size and the scale of how right or wrong they eventually are.
“There is a chance that Tiger Woods will be sent off the shortest price favourite ever for a Major on Thursday afternoon,” predicts Sporting Index spokesman Wally Pyrah. “However, let’s not forget that there are over 90 other runners”.
The World Leaders in their sector also predict that only 13 players will finish under par and that the winning score will be 9 under. They expect the tournament to be won by 2 shots, with the lowest round of the week being a 65.
